See the GNU General Public License * version 2 for more details (a copy is included in the LICENSE file that * accompanied this code). * *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License version * 2 along with this work;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ation, * Inc., 51 Franklin St,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A. * * Please contact Oracle, 500 Oracle Parkway, Redwood Shores, CA 94065 USA * or visit www.oracle.com if you need additional information or have any * questions. */ import static javax.crypto.Cipher.getMaxAllowedKeyLength; import java.security.InvalidKeyException; import java.security.Key; import java.security.NoSuchAlgorithmException; import java.security.NoSuchProviderException; import java.util.Arrays; import java.util.List; import javax.crypto.Cipher; import javax.crypto.IllegalBlockSizeException; import javax.crypto.KeyGenerator; import javax.crypto.NoSuchPaddingException; import javax.crypto.SecretKey; /* * @test * @bug 8075286 * @summary Test the AESWrap algorithm OIDs in JDK. * OID and Algorithm transformation string should match. * Both could be able to be used to generate the algorithm instance. * @run main TestAESWrapOids */ public class TestAESWrapOids { private static final String PROVIDER_NAME = "SunJCE"; private static final List<DataTuple> DATA = Arrays.asList( new DataTuple("2.16.840.1.101.3.4.1.5", "AESWrap_128", 128), new DataTuple("2.16.840.1.101.3.4.1.25", "AESWrap_192", 192), new DataTuple("2.16.840.1.101.3.4.1.45", "AESWrap_256", 256)); public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ception { for (DataTuple dataTuple : DATA) { int maxAllowedKeyLength = getMaxAllowedKeyLength( dataTuple.algorithm); boolean supportedKeyLength = maxAllowedKeyLength >= dataTuple.keyLength; try { runTest(dataTuple, supportedKeyLength); System.out.println("passed"); } catch (InvalidKeyException ike) { if (supportedKeyLength) { throw new RuntimeException(String.format( "The key length %d is supported, but test failed.", dataTuple.keyLength), ike); } else { System.out.printf( "Catch expected InvalidKeyException " + "due to the key length %d is greater " + "than max supported key length %d%n", dataTuple.keyLength, maxAllowedKeyLength); } } } } private static void runTest(DataTuple dataTuple, boolean supportedKeyLength) throws NoSuchAlgorithmException, NoSuchProviderException, NoSuchPaddingException, InvalidKeyException, IllegalBlockSizeException { Cipher algorithmCipher = Cipher.getInstance( dataTuple.algorithm, PROVIDER_NAME); Cipher oidCipher = Cipher.getInstance(dataTuple.oid, PROVIDER_NAME); if (algorithmCipher == null) { throw new RuntimeException(String.format( "Test failed: algorithm string %s getInstance failed.%n", dataTuple.algorithm)); } if (oidCipher == null) { throw new RuntimeException( String.format("Test failed: OID %s getInstance failed.%n", dataTuple.oid)); } if (!algorithmCipher.getAlgorithm().equals( dataTuple.algorithm)) { throw new RuntimeException(String.format( "Test failed: algorithm string %s getInstance " + "doesn't generate expected algorithm.%n", dataTuple.oid)); } KeyGenerator kg = KeyGenerator.getInstance("AES"); kg.init(dataTuple.keyLength); SecretKey key = kg.generateKey(); // Wrap the key algorithmCipher.init(Cipher.WRAP_MODE, key); if (!supportedKeyLength) { throw new RuntimeException(String.format( "The key length %d is not supported, so the initialization" + " of algorithmCipher should fail.%n", dataTuple.keyLength)); } // Unwrap the key oidCipher.init(Cipher.UNWRAP_MODE, key); if (!supportedKeyLength) { throw new RuntimeException(String.format( "The key length %d is not supported, so the initialization" + " of oidCipher should fail.%n", dataTuple.keyLength)); } byte[] keyWrapper = algorithmCipher.wrap(key); Key unwrappedKey = oidCipher.unwrap(keyWrapper, "AES", Cipher.SECRET_KEY); // Comparison if (!Arrays.equals(key.getEncoded(), unwrappedKey.getEncoded())) { throw new RuntimeException("Key comparison failed"); } } private static class DataTuple { private final String oid; private final String algorithm; private final int keyLength; private DataTuple(String oid, String algorithm, int keyLength) { this.oid = oid; this.algorithm = algorithm; this.keyLength = keyLength; } } }
